debuggerd_handler: actually wait for pseudothread to exit.

Occasionally, the pseudothread wouldn't exit in time after unlocking
the mutex to get crash_dump to proceed, resulting in spurious error
messages. Instead of using a mutex to emulate pthread_join, just
implement it correctly.
